Brandilyn and Amberly Collins are a mother/daughter team from northern California. Brandilyn is a bestselling novelist, known for her trademarked "Seatbelt Suspense". Amberly is a college student in southern California. Their first novel is Always Watching.

Why did you decide to write as a mother/daughter team?

Amberly: Well, initially when we were offered this opportunity it struck me as a great experience I normally wouldn't get on my own (if I wasn't the daughter of a bestselling author). So I jumped at the idea. I thought it would be different to have not only a mother daughter team but an author as young as I am to help reach the younger audience.

Brandilyn: My publisher, Zondervan, can be credited for coming up with the idea. Zondervan was launching a YA line and, since I was already with the house as an adult suspense author, they approached me with the idea of writing with Amberly. How could I say no to the chance to write with my wonderful daughter?

How did you come up with the idea for a “Rock Concert” setting for this new series?

Amberly: We’ve always enjoyed concerts together, so it seemed fitting to immerse ourselves and the story in a world we only on occasion get to enjoy.

Brandilyn: We also thought our readers would find the life of a rock star’s daughter both exciting and intriguing. What is life really like for a girl of such privileges? What kinds of personal struggles might she endure that the world never sees?

Tell us about Shaley O’Connor. What kind of girl is she? Is her character based in any way on Amberly?

Amberly: She's not really based on me except for the love of clothes. Certain aspects of her life I intentionally wanted to create because they were things I would like to have if I was a rock star’s daughter—for instance, the glitzy side of her life.

Brandilyn-what is it like writing for a younger audience?

Brandilyn: I’ve always found it interesting to write in the younger point of view. All the books in my Kanner Lake series, and some of my other novels have supporting characters who are teenagers. It’s a fresh, different voice. In writing this series it was very helpful to have Amberly’s insights in getting that younger POV right.

Amberly-what is it like having a bestselling author for a mom?

Amberly: Well..it’s interesting! She's somewhat of a scatterbrain sometimes and occasionally talks to herself when she walks away from her computer but is still stuck in her writing. But it’s fun. I'm proud she's made it as far as she has.

Brandilyn, you have a busy writing schedule for your adult titles and Amberly, you’re in college. How do you two find time to write together with your busy schedules?

Amberly: We've been lucky so far because we've been able to work around school and collaborate during breaks and summers. Right now in my free time I've just been doing plotting sessions for the 3rd book by myself until we’re together again.

This series is suspense and does involve murder, so how is it different than the “vampire suspense” titles popular in the general market right now?

Brandilyn: Through Shaley’s struggles, and all the murder and mayhem, runs a theme of truth—that God is with us always and is so willing to be a part of our lives and help us navigate this world if we choose to let Him. After the exciting story is done, I hope that truth sticks with the reader.

How do you hope Shaley’s adventures will inspire teens to live a life of faith? Why should teens read this series?

Amberly: I think it’s important for teens, whether they're Christian or not, to see how Shaley grows and learns about God during hard times. This message is subtle and not overbearing, so our hope is that teens can see how to reach out to God in times of need and walk with Him on a regular basis as well.

What’s next for Shaley and her mom in The Rayne Tour series?

Brandilyn: The second book, Last Breath, starts right where Always Watching leaves off. Always Watching solves the murder mystery within it, yet hints of a whole new mystery for Shaley arise. She must seek the truth about his new mystery in Last Breath. Book #2 is full of surprises, as is book #1. The most important challenge in a series is to write a second book as strong as the first. We both think we’ve done that.
